Norris Admits Overcoming Verstappen at Italian GP is 'Big Challenge' After P2 Qualifying

Lando Norris qualified P2 for the Italian GP, admitting it will be a "big challenge" to beat pole-sitter Max Verstappen. Teammate Oscar Piastri starts P3.

Why it matters: Lando Norris qualified second for the Italian Grand Prix, putting McLaren in a strong position, but he acknowledges the formidable challenge of beating pole-sitter Max Verstappen. His teammate Oscar Piastri will start P3, highlighting McLaren's strong form.### The details: * Norris missed pole by just 0.077 seconds, with Verstappen setting a record lap at Monza.* The Briton described his qualifying session as "up and down" with "too many mistakes," but expressed satisfaction with his final P2 effort.* "Max has been quicker this weekend, and it's never a surprise with Max," Norris stated, underscoring Verstappen's dominant pace.* He added, "Our race on Sunday is normally our strength. But to get past Max, I'm sure it's going to be a big challenge."* Norris also highlighted the threat from behind, noting the strong pace of the Ferraris.### Meanwhile, Piastri... * Oscar Piastri, starting P3, expressed confidence despite a "trickier" weekend, having missed FP1.* He admitted the competition has been "incredibly tight," with many teams showing strong pace.### What's next: McLaren aims to leverage its strong race pace in Sunday's Grand Prix, but faces a tough battle against Red Bull and the home-crowd motivated Ferraris. Norris emphasized that "many things can happen" in a long race at Monza.
